What is soul?

Soul

Humans have two lives.

Towards the end of the Book (Genesis 2:7), vital information is provided about the human creation, Adam.

It shows that Adam didn’t come alive after God formed him, only until God blew his spirit into Adam’s nostril he become a living being, a living soul (King James Version).

So what does this mean?
We have two lives:
One is physical, which is tied to the earthly world.
The other is spiritual, bound to God because God blew his spirit into Adam, only then he came to life.

Therefore, while our physical body will decay by going back to earth, our spiritual body will ascend to heaven or descend to hell.

Holy Bible

Soul comes from God.

Genesis 2:1-6
New Living Translation (NLT)

So the creation of the heavens and the earth and everything in them was completed. On the seventh day God had finished his work of creation, so he rested from all his work. And God blessed the seventh day and declared it holy, because it was the day when he rested from all his work of creation.(The scripture shows how the jewish tradition Sabbath was formed)

This is the account of the creation of the heavens and the earth.

When the Lord God made the earth and the heavens, neither wild plants nor grains were growing on the earth. For the Lord God had not yet sent rain to water the earth, and there were no people to cultivate the soil. Instead, springs came up from the ground and watered all the land.

Genesis 2:7
(New Living Translation)
Then the Lord God formed the man from the dust of the ground. He breathed the breath of life into the man’s nostrils, and the man became a living person.

(King James Version)
And the Lord God formed man of the dust of the ground, and breathed into his nostrils the breath of life; and man became a living soul.
